Calhoun v. State, 111 S.E. 65, 28 Ga. App. 327, 1922 Ga. App. LEXIS 485 (Ga. Ct. App. 1922).
Opinion
There is evidence to authorize the verdict, which has' the approval of the trial judge, and it was not error to overrule the motion for a new trial.
Judgment affirmed.
